Position: Drainage Engineer, Austin, TX

Key Qualifications:
  1.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or related field from an ABET/EAC accredited program.
  2. Licensed Professional Engineer with over 5 years of hydraulic design experience.
  3. Proficient in HEC-HMS, HEC-RAS, HEC-RAS 2D, HY-8, GEOPAK Drainage, XP SWMM, and either MicroStation or AutoCAD.
  4. Strong command of Microsoft Office suite.
  5. Exceptional communication skills, both written and verbal.
